Output 60cc4913d5b08438b5d400ce11fc5f82ffe301c461208d100b26f0aa0ff63265:0

value
24059679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7f511f5537b9334821ff376e68e6b97ba0d073 OP_EQUAL
address
3N4m8THzrCzByFA512xPanNN6oyuBJAZAx
transaction
60cc4913d5b08438b5d400ce11fc5f82ffe301c461208d100b26f0aa0ff63265
confirmations
339633
spent
true